Audacy Inks Two Content Distribution Agreements

Audacy inks a series of content distribution partnerships to bolster the reach of "You Better You Bet," a sports betting live show and podcast in the U.S. The show with co-hosts Nick Kostos and Ken Barkley is heard on BetQL Network, Audacy's network of sports betting content.

The company has partnered with Stadium, an interactive sports network, to bring "You Better You Bet" to audiences nationwide via Stadium's portfolio, WatchStadium.com/Live and Stadium affiliates YouTubeTV, The Roku Channel, FuboTV, Amazon, Samsung TV Plus, Tubi and more. "You Better You Bet" airs on Stadium weekdays from 4-6pm ET.

Audacy has also announced a deal with SiriusXM to air "You Better You Bet" on Sirius channel 217, XM channel 205 and on the SiriusXM app. The show will be heard weekdays from 3-7pm ET beginning October 2.

"We're thrilled to announce these strategic agreements with Stadium and SiriusXM, which will significantly expand the reach of 'You Better You Bet,' solidifying its position as the number one sports betting podcast in the U.S.," said BetQL Network Vice President Mitch Rosen. "Our commitment to delivering top-tier sports betting entertainment to a wider audience has never been stronger, and we look forward to introducing Nick and Ken to new audiences across multiple touchpoints nationwide."
